ADAP is dispensable for NK cell development and function
Lindsey V Fostel1, Joanna Dluzniewska, Yoji Shimizu
1Department of Internal Medicine, University of Minnesota Medical School, Center for Immunology, Cancer Center, University of Minnesota, Minneapolis, 55455, USA.
Adhesion and degranulation-promoting adapter protein (ADAP) is not essential for natural killer (NK) cell development or function. ADAP-deficient mice exhibit normal NK cell activity, indicating its dispensability in NK-mediated anti-tumor responses.

Background:
- Natural killer (NK) cells are crucial for innate immunity and anti-tumor surveillance.
- Adhesion and degranulation-promoting adapter protein (ADAP) is vital for T cell receptor (TCR) signaling and activation in other immune cells.
Purpose of the Study:
- To investigate the role of ADAP in the development and function of NK cells.
- To determine if ADAP is required for NK cell-mediated anti-tumor surveillance.
Main Methods:
- Analysis of ADAP expression in primary NK cells and IL-2 stimulated lymphokine-activated killer (LAK) cells.
- Phenotypic and functional assessment of NK cells from ADAP-deficient mice.
- Evaluation of NK cell cytotoxicity, cytokine production, conjugate formation, and in vivo tumor suppression.
Main Results:
- ADAP is expressed in NK cells, but ADAP-deficient mice show no defects in NK cell development.
- ADAP is dispensable for key NK cell functions, including cytotoxicity, cytokine release, and conjugate formation.
- ADAP is not required for in vivo tumor suppression mediated by NK cells.
Conclusions:
- ADAP is not essential for NK cell development or function.
- Signaling pathways engaged by NK cell receptors can operate independently of ADAP, unlike TCR signaling pathways.
